Content :

The pupils are made to role play the roles of father and mother in the family and other pupils are made to greet the father and mother in the family . The class  teacher also guides the pupils in the area of greetings and responses

 

In the morning you will greet your daddy by saying good morning sir ang you will greet your mummy by saying good morning Ma

 

In the afternoon you will greet your daddy by saying good afternoon Sir and you will greet your mummy by saying good afternoon Ma 

 

In the evening you will greet you daddy by saying good evening sir and you will greet your mummy by saying good evening  Ma 

 

Boys will prostrate  will greetings and girls will knee down while greeting according to yoruba culture and tradition

 

When a friend has come into the class , you will say Welcome Ma or Sir

When a friend is about to leave the classroom , you will say Goodbye
